At the mega Congress rally titled 'Bharat Bachao', Congress leaders are attacking the BJP for its "divisive and disruptive" policies. 

In a vehement reaction to BJP's demand for apology on "Rape in India" remark, Congress leader Rahul Gandhi says he would not apologise. "My name is Rahul Gandhi not Rahul Savarkar. I stand with the truth." Rahul says it is PM Modi and Home minister of the country who need to apologise to the country.

"It is Narendra Modi and his assistant Amit Shah who have to apologise to the country for destroying India's economy. Today, the GDP growth is at 4%, that too even after the BJP changed the way to measure GDP. If GDP is measured using the previous method, it will be just 2.5%," he added.
